Legal matters can often be complex and overwhelming, which is why many individuals turn to lawyers for help and guidance. However, what happens when your lawyer fails to meet your expectations or breaches their duty to you? In such cases, you may find yourself contemplating suing your lawyer in The Woodlands.

One of the first steps in pursuing legal action against your lawyer is determining whether they have committed legal malpractice. This can include acts such as negligence, breach of fiduciary duty, or conflicts of interest. It is important to gather evidence and documentation to support your claim, as well as seek advice from another legal professional to assess the viability of your case.

Before moving forward with a lawsuit, it is crucial to consider the potential consequences and costs involved. Litigation can be time-consuming, emotionally draining, and expensive. You may also need to weigh the likelihood of success and whether it is worth pursuing legal action against your lawyer.

Ultimately, suing your lawyer is a serious decision that should not be taken lightly. It is important to carefully weigh your options, seek legal advice, and consider alternative dispute resolution methods before proceeding with a lawsuit. By taking a methodical and informed approach, you can navigate the complexities of legal malpractice and protect your rights as a client.
